Preguntas frecuentes sobre Tompkins County

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Tompkins County?

Actualmente hay 42 Apartamentos Estudios en Tompkins County con alquileres que van desde $900 hasta $2,946, con un precio medio de $1,876.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Tompkins County?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Tompkins County varian entre $650 y $4,434 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,955

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Tompkins County?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Tompkins County van desde $950 hasta $4,803.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,367

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Tompkins County?

En estos momentos hay 114 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Tompkins County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$750 y $5,935 - con una media de $2,564 para el lugar.
